USD Coin is a stablecoin that is pegged to the U.S. dollar on a 1:1 basis. The stablecoin was originally launched on a limited basis in September 2018. Put simply, USD Coin’s mantra is 'digital money for the digital age'— and the stablecoin is designed for a world where cashless transactions are becoming more common. USD Coin has aimed to stand head and shoulders over competitors in several ways. One of them concerns transparency and assurance that users will be able to withdraw 1 USDC and receive $1 in return without any issues.

Players earn X tokens by completing tasks, engaging in PvP battles, and inviting friends. The project also develops exclusive utility apps for X holders, including Feed (content management for Telegram), Langs (language learning), and Sleep (sleep tracking).
